> I don't have a whole lot to offer except that gcc now generates
> this instruction and the simulator needs it. The RTEMS test code
> which made gcc generate this instruction now run correctly. Those
> tests are not specifically of this instruction by itself but of an
> entire program where gcc generated it.
>
> So things are better with this patch than without. Without,
> you get an exception and die. With it, you run.
>
> If the comments stay, is the patch OK?
No, on comment out location GDB code just won't compile.
But at new (for me ;) ) more appropriate location compiles without problems.
